Why Monitoring FPS Matters
FPS, or Frames Per Second, is a critical metric for gamers and digital creatives alike. It tells you how smoothly a game or video application is running by measuring the number of frames displayed per second. **Higher FPS** indicates smoother gameplay and responsiveness, which is especially important for fast-paced games or applications requiring precision. Lower FPS, on the other hand, often results in lag, stuttering, and an overall frustrating experience.
By monitoring your FPS, you gain insight into the performance of your hardware and can troubleshoot potential issues before they become major disruptions. It allows you to **fine-tune settings**, enabling you to find the perfect balance between visuals and performance. Tools for Monitoring FPS
Several tools make it easy to track FPS across various games and applications. Here are some popular options:
- NVIDIA GeForce Experience: Built into NVIDIA’s suite, this software provides an overlay that displays FPS and other performance metrics.
- MSI Afterburner: A popular choice for both monitoring FPS and adjusting hardware settings, MSI Afterburner supports most graphics cards and offers extensive customization options.
- Fraps: Fraps is a straightforward tool for FPS monitoring, often used for benchmarking performance in games and applications.
- Steam’s In-Game Overlay: For games on Steam, the in-game overlay includes a simple FPS counter. It’s an easy solution if you primarily play games through the Steam platform.
Each of these tools offers its unique benefits, but the choice largely depends on your preferences and whether you require additional performance metrics beyond FPS.
Step-by-Step Guide to Monitoring FPS
Monitoring FPS may seem daunting initially, but with the right tools and a clear process, it becomes straightforward. Follow these steps to ensure you’re monitoring FPS effectively:
Step 1: Install an FPS Monitoring Tool
If you haven’t already, download and install an FPS monitoring tool. Many popular tools like **MSI Afterburner** and **NVIDIA GeForce Experience** are free and compatible with most systems. For users who need in-depth insights, consider tools like Radeon Overlay for AMD graphics cards, or external performance monitoring devices.
Step 2: Configure the FPS Overlay
Once your preferred tool is installed, open the settings to activate the FPS overlay. This overlay will appear on your screen during gameplay or other high-demand applications. Adjust the position, color, and size of the overlay to ensure it’s easily visible without obstructing critical parts of the screen.
Step 3: Start the Game or Application
After configuring your overlay, launch the game or application you wish to monitor. The FPS counter should now be visible. Keep an eye on this counter, especially during high-action scenes or intensive graphical moments. You may notice FPS variations based on activity within the game or software.
Step 4: Make Adjustments Based on FPS
If your FPS drops significantly, consider adjusting settings. Lowering graphics settings, reducing the resolution, or disabling visual effects can help improve FPS. Conversely, if your FPS is consistently high, you may increase settings for better visual quality.
Understanding FPS Ranges and What They Mean
Different FPS levels impact the gaming experience in various ways. Here’s a breakdown of typical FPS ranges and what they imply for gameplay:
- 30 FPS: Considered the minimum acceptable frame rate for gaming, especially on consoles. Playable but may feel sluggish during intense scenes.
- 60 FPS: Generally ideal for smooth, responsive gameplay, especially for single-player games.
- 120 FPS and above: The gold standard for fast-paced or competitive games, like shooters or racing games. Results in fluid animations and precise controls.
Ultimately, the ideal FPS depends on the game and your expectations. Competitive gamers often aim for the highest FPS possible to ensure optimal performance, while casual players may prioritize graphical fidelity over extreme responsiveness.
Common FPS Issues and How to Troubleshoot Them
Encountering FPS issues can be frustrating, especially in critical gaming moments. Here are some common FPS problems and practical troubleshooting tips:
Problem 1: Sudden FPS Drops
**Solution:** Sudden FPS drops usually occur due to background processes or temperature increases. Close unnecessary applications running in the background, especially resource-heavy ones like browsers or other games. Additionally, check your hardware temperature. Overheating can lead to thermal throttling, which reduces performance. Use your monitoring tool to check GPU and CPU temperatures, ensuring they stay within safe limits.
Problem 2: Low FPS Despite High-End Hardware
**Solution:** If you’re experiencing low FPS despite powerful hardware, verify that your drivers are up-to-date. Outdated GPU drivers can often cause performance issues. Visit the official website of your graphics card manufacturer (such as NVIDIA) to download the latest drivers.
Problem 3: Stuttering or Freezing
**Solution:** Stuttering can result from inconsistent frame pacing or memory shortages. Try lowering the graphics settings and resolution, especially if your device has limited RAM. You might also benefit from enabling V-Sync, which helps with frame synchronization and reduces screen tearing.
Problem 4: Poor Network Connection
**Solution:** In online games, lag and FPS drops can sometimes be caused by network issues rather than hardware. If you’re facing lag, check your internet connection and consider using a wired connection if possible. Reducing the network’s workload, such as by closing streaming apps, can also improve your connection stability.
Optimizing Your FPS for the Best Gaming Experience
Optimizing FPS involves fine-tuning both software and hardware settings. Here are a few practical tips to ensure your system is performing at its peak:
- Keep Software Updated: Ensure your GPU drivers and game software are up-to-date. Updates often include performance improvements or bug fixes that can enhance FPS.
- Adjust Power Settings: Set your computer to “High Performance” mode in the power settings to ensure it’s allocating maximum resources to gaming.
- Optimize Game Settings: Experiment with in-game settings like shadows, textures, and anti-aliasing. Lowering these settings can significantly increase FPS without drastically affecting visual quality.
- Consider Hardware Upgrades: If you’re consistently struggling to maintain a good FPS, upgrading components like the GPU, CPU, or RAM can make a substantial difference.
How to Interpret FPS Metrics for Long-Term Monitoring
Monitoring FPS over time can help you understand your system’s performance baseline and detect when issues arise. By regularly checking FPS metrics, you’ll notice if your hardware starts underperforming, which could indicate the need for maintenance, such as **dust removal** or **thermal paste reapplication**.
Some advanced FPS monitoring tools offer the option to log FPS data, which can be useful for identifying patterns and understanding when performance dips occur. This data provides insights for gamers aiming to continually optimize their system.
